Output 3ec4d4e661e329f388cdaad954ae12f46bb05f9947df0a6acfc4ab2f89fa8337:1

value
2809432
script pubkey
OP_0 OP_PUSHBYTES_20 2053304c7946cf0c93d86e466aa77dfb836761e1
address
bc1qypfnqnregm8sey7cderx4fmalwpkwc0pc67qgx
transaction
3ec4d4e661e329f388cdaad954ae12f46bb05f9947df0a6acfc4ab2f89fa8337
confirmations
901
spent
true